Ticket: Staging env misconfigured for Siftgate bloom filter

The bloom layer in front of the Pellet KV store is rejecting all lookups in staging because the env file was copied from the dev template without credentials. False-positive tuning values are fine; only the auth line is missing. To unblock the weekly demo, the Pellet admission secret must be set on the following line.

env line for yaguf-fajop: LEDGER_TOKEN13=fb08984397349

Q: Thumbnail queue (Gristmill) is backed up — what do I check first?

A: Check consumer lag and dead-letter count. Most backlogs come from oversized source images timing out the resizer; requeue those with the large-media profile. If lag grows while workers sit idle, the claim lease is likely stuck — restart the claimer, not the workers. Do not drain the queue manually; dedupe depends on queue order. Scaling past 12 workers needs approval. Dashboards, requeue commands, and escalation steps are on the internal page.

dashboard of yaguf-hahig = https://grafana.urlaqworks.test/secrets

Handover: charset sniffing in Textgrove

Hey Marek — before you review the branch, some context. Textgrove's encoding detection for uploaded text files now runs a two-pass sniff: byte-order marks first, then a statistical pass using the Ferndale tables. The old heuristic mislabeled Turkish and Czech files constantly, hence the rewrite. Mixed-encoding files fall back to a configurable default rather than erroring. The detector reads its thresholds from the settings pasted below.

config for kaguf-tahop:
fenir:
  pin: 0174
  tenant: novix
  seal: seal_58ebeb9f
  metrics_host: metrics.fenir.halixsoft.corp
  standby_team: gilys
  escalation: weniel-feniel
  nonce: 50fe55

# Artifact Signing — Quenchpool Autoscaler

All release artifacts for the Quenchpool queue-depth autoscaler are signed before upload to the internal registry. The CI stage `sign-artifacts` runs after the build and attaches a detached signature to each tarball. Maintainers must verify signatures before promoting a build to the stable channel; unsigned artifacts are rejected by the deploy gate. Rotation happens every six months, tracked on the Opsboard. The current deploy key is recorded below.

deploy key for yajop-fahop: bky3_h1v